Sant Carles de la Ràpita

Sant Carles de la Ràpita is a picturesque coastal town located in the province of Tarragona, in the northeastern region of Catalonia, Spain. Known for its beautiful beaches, excellent seafood, and rich cultural heritage, it is a popular destination for tourists from all over the world.

One of the main attractions in Sant Carles de la Ràpita is its long, sandy beach, which is perfect for sunbathing, swimming, and water sports. There are also several smaller coves and beaches nearby that offer more secluded and tranquil spots to enjoy the Mediterranean Sea.

Another must-see attraction in Sant Carles de la Ràpita is the town’s historic center, which is home to several beautiful examples of Catalan modernist architecture. Visitors can stroll through the narrow streets and admire the colorful facades of the buildings, as well as the ornate details and decorative elements that are characteristic of this style.

Food lovers will also find plenty to enjoy in Sant Carles de la Ràpita, as the town is known for its excellent seafood restaurants that serve fresh, locally caught fish and shellfish. Some of the most popular dishes include paella, arroz negro (black rice), and fideuà, which is a type of noodle dish similar to paella.

In addition to its beautiful beaches, historic center, and excellent cuisine, Sant Carles de la Ràpita is also home to several festivals and cultural events throughout the year. One of the most popular is the Festa Major, which takes place in August and features traditional Catalan music, dance, and food.
